Как мне исправить новую версию Snap для Chromium, чтобы она запускалась?

Ubuntu 20.04.1 LTS Focal Fossa
Chromium 87.0.4280.66

Проблема

Недавно я обновил Ubuntu 18.04.5 до 20.04.1, т.е.Software Upgrader написал новую версию всех файлов приложения вместо своих предшественников. Во время обновления версия Chromium .deb была удалена и заменена версией snap 87.0.4280.66.

Однако, когда я дважды щелкаю значок Chromium, он запускается, и веб-браузер Chromium появляется на панели действий рабочего стола, но затем исчезает. Я попытался удалить и переустановить оснастку с помощью программного обеспечения Ubuntu и Synaptic, но Chromium продолжал вести себя так же.

canberra-gtk-module предупреждения

При запуске из Терминала происходит следующее:

~$ which chromium
/snap/bin/chromium
~$ echo $PATH
/opt/gutenprint/sbin:/opt/gutenprint/bin:/opt/GitHub Desktop: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/snap/bin:/usr/local/bin/node:  

~$ chromium  

(chrome:40586): Gtk-WARNING **: 19:46:29.670: Theme parsing error: gtk.css:1565:23: 'font-feature-settings' is not a valid property name

(chrome:40586): Gtk-WARNING **: 19:46:29.674: Theme parsing error: gtk.css:3615:25: 'font-feature-settings' is not a valid property name

(chrome:40586): Gtk-WARNING **: 19:46:29.675: Theme parsing error: gtk.css:4077:23: 'font-feature-settings' is not a valid property name
Gtk-Message: 19:46:29.706: Failed to load module "canberra-gtk-module"
Gtk-Message: 19:46:29.707: Failed to load module "canberra-gtk-module"
[40722:40722:1130/194629.798673:ERROR:sandbox_linux.cc(374)] InitializeSandbox() called with multiple threads in process gpu-process.
Trace/breakpoint trap (core dumped)
~$ 

Я попытался установить libcanberra-gtk-module *, libcanberra -gtk3-module , libcanberra-gtk3-0 , libcanberra-gtk-module: i386 , libcanberra-gtk3-module: i386 и libcanberra-gtk3-0: i386 , как было предложено в ответе, но последние версии уже были установлены. Chromium по-прежнему не запускается.

Эта проблема возникла в Ubuntu 11 - см. https://bugs.launchpad.net/ubuntu/+source/libcanberra/+bug/689434

Установлена ​​проверенная версия Chromium с моментальным снимком

Попытка ручная установка Chromium snap:

~$ sudo snap install chromium
snap "chromium" is already installed, see 'snap help refresh'
~$ sudo snap refresh
All snaps up to date.

Куда?

Идеи заканчиваются. Приветствуются новые идеи!


* Канберра - столица Австралии. При чем здесь этот пакет?

1
задан 1 December 2020 в 10:51

1 ответ

Эта ошибка исчезнет, ​​если вы войдете в систему и выйдете из нее. Сначала я попытался устранить ошибку Theme parsing error: gtk.css:xxxx:xx: 'font-feature-settings' не является допустимым именем свойства , открыв приложение System Monitor и убивая все процессы Chromium по одному. Это привело к тому, что рабочий стол Ubuntu 20.04 был заменен черным экраном. Я нажал комбинацию клавиш Ctrl+Alt+F3, чтобы выйти из черного экрана в виртуальную консоль. Когда я снова вошел в Ubuntu с виртуальной консоли, автоматически появился обычный экран входа в Ubuntu, и я смог войти в систему. После входа в систему Chromium снова возобновил работу, как обычно.

0
ответ дан 26 January 2021 в 11:39

Другие вопросы по тегам:

Похожие вопросы: